Sadie Haller The most recent book is the third in the series and is being written concurrently with the second, so technically, I'd say the inspiration comes from what inspired the series itself.

There is no shortage of kinky rock star stories, which I certainly enjoy reading, but as a classically trained musician with a broad kinky streak, I felt woefully under-represented.

With not much more than the notion of a chamber group made up entirely of Doms, and an oboe playing rape survivor with severe performance anxiety, I started writing. I had the first draft for One Gold Heart finished in just ten days.

One Gold Knot was inspired by an early cover mock-up for One Gold Heart and a conversation I had with my daughter about weddings and funerals.

One Gold Triquetra was inspired by a a passing thought I had as I was writing One Gold Knot. What if two of the Doms secretly had a relationship with each other?
Sadie Haller Distraction and procrastination. I do something else. Sometimes, it's write something else, sometimes, it's an activity completely unrelated to writing.

I find it's kind of like when you can't remember something, like the name of a song, or an actor - the harder you think on it, the deeper it's buried in your memory, but once you move onto something else, it'll pop into your brain uninvited.
